You can only simplify, and by the way you wrote it, it is a bit confusing. I'll assume you mean:

8y + 2 - 18y -5.

In order to do this you must combine like terms, or the same things. We can combine 8y and -18y, as they are both y.

8y - 18y = -10y.

Now we can combine 2 and -5, as they both are plain.

2 - 5 = -3.

Your final answer would be:

-10y - 3.
